Effect of noise on the Stroop test.

Abstract

Abstract : Noise increases the interference between colours and conflicting colour names. The interference increases with the time spent in the noise. This could be due to the overarousal produced by the noise, or to the perceptual isolation which the noise also produces. (Author)
